High Noon Holsters: A Dark Horse Cometh!

A Dark Horse!

There is no betting that a holster from High Noon Holsters.. will be a winner or not.

Some just work better for me (and others) as do any gun related products on the market.

Sleek and Beautiful!

Those are two words that can describe this new holster.

Two more: All Business!

Truthfully,

After my last of a High Noon product, the Second Skin rig.

I went in search on the High Noon website for a holster that might have wider appeal than
the synthetic material Skin Deep snap style holster.

Since my color preference for winter carry is black.

My choice was the Need For Speed in black horsehide.

I'm thrilled with the resulting holster that took less than a week to arrive during the
super busy (Christmas Eve) holiday season.

Now in 2009. This holster is working out superbly.


Unlike some HN horsehide holsters in the past. This one was tight from the word Go.

Has loosened up a bit with carry, but still tighter than me equally excellent HN Speedy Spanky
paddle holster in natural horsehide.

The Need For Speed features a sewn in sight track, using black thread that is evenly stitched and
very strong.

Rough side out, with the smooth horsehide on the inside.

Giving this holster a unique look that I really like!

A reinforced mouth/trim of smooth horsehide has the same stitching and keeps the holster open until you replace
your RAMI (or other pistol) inside.


Tension is adjustable with a screw, but my holster is still to new/tight to worry about it.
I had to remove the rubber buffer.. but it will go back on if needed in the future.

The cant seems more neutral than a extreme FBI rake, as found on the Skin Deep or other holsters on the market.

Meaning that the holster is more vertical to your body.

A belt loop in the back and tight belt loop tunnel ensure that the holster rides very close and that
in my opinion combined with a perfect rake for me....makes it rides higher than the Skin Deep.

This will allow me a holster that is both fast on the draw (after break in) and still secure.
Plus, the higher riding holster (for me) will allow me to wear shorter vests when I want.

Superbly crafted out of premium horsehide (or leather) with strong stitching and close attention to detail.

The Need For Speed might just be your answer for your CCW needs.
